Re: ID info/help
Yes, black margin on dorsal and caudal fins on L102 only (but see my next paragraph). Also spots are smaller and closer together on face than on body of L102. L201 has more homogeneous size and spacing to its spots over the whole body.
Keep in mind there are now three look-alikes in this group: L102 has now been concluded to be a different fish from (but our Cat-eLog has not been changed to reflect this new conclusion), and there is a third look-alike: .
So be careful if you buy from different sources that you don't mix types.

Re: ID info/help
The black in all its fins is very striking in L102 and is missing in L201.
L102 has small spots on his face and bigger spots on his back and fins while L201 has roughly homogeneous spots. Hope this will help. Cheers Johannes
